Understanding French Door Windows: Elegance Meets Functionality
French door windows have become associated with classic sophistication and useful design in contemporary architecture and home restorations. These elegant structures supply not just aesthetic appeal but likewise performance by permitting ample light and fluidity in between areas. This article explores the various elements of French door windows, including their types, advantages, setup considerations, upkeep, and often asked concerns.
What are French Door Windows?
French door windows are normally defined by their dual-door design, featuring a series of glass panes that offer an unobstructed view and easy access to outside areas. While conventional French doors are hinged, contemporary iterations often come in sliding or bi-fold setups. These doors can be made use of in numerous settings, including outdoor patios, gardens, and even inside your home to separate various living locations.
Table 1: Comparison of French Door Styles
Style | Description | Pros | Cons |
---|---|---|---|
Hinged French Doors | Doors that open external or inward when unlatched. | Stylish appearance; traditional design. | Needs clearance space for opening. |
Sliding French Doors | Doors move along a track instead of opening outwards. | Space-saving; much easier for high traffic. | May have a lower visual appeal. |
Bi-fold French Doors | Several panels that fold and stack to one side. | Maximizes opening, terrific for gain access to. | Can be more costly; needs more space. |
Benefits of French Door Windows
French door windows come with a wide range of benefits that make them an appealing choice for homeowners:
- Natural Light: The substantial glass design welcomes natural light into the home, lightening up rooms and decreasing the requirement for artificial lighting.
- Visual Appeal: Their traditional style boosts the aesthetic of a home, including sophistication and sophistication. They can become a centerpiece in foyers, dining rooms, or living spaces.
- Increased Ventilation: French doors can be opened totally to supply outstanding cross-ventilation, reducing indoor humidity and improving air quality.
- Versatility: They can be utilized in a range of areas, such as outdoor patios, balconies, gardens, or as interior dividers.
- Increased Property Value: The addition of French door windows can enhance the attraction of a property, making it more attractive to possible buyers.
Popular French Door Window Materials
French doors can be made from a range of materials, each of which has its own unique functions:
- Wood: Traditional option understood for its charm and insulation homes. However, wood requires routine upkeep.
- Vinyl: Low upkeep with excellent energy effectiveness. Readily available in various colors and styles but usually less conventional in look.
- Aluminum: Durable and resistant to weather, enabling for large panes of glass. However, they conduct heat, so they might not be as energy-efficient.
- Fiberglass: Offers the appearance of wood but with low upkeep. It's energy-efficient and resistant to warping.
Installation Considerations
When planning to install French door windows, a number of aspects must be taken into consideration:
- Space: Ensure that there is sufficient space for the design picked, particularly for hinged or bi-fold doors that need clearance for opening.
- Design and style: Consider the architectural design of the home and select a style that matches it.
- Energy Efficiency: Look for doors with double glazing and premium seals to decrease energy loss.
- Regional Climate: Some door products perform much better in specific environments. For example, wood might swell in humid conditions, while aluminum is more suited for coastal locations.
- Expert Help: Installation might require professional competence, especially if structural changes are required.
Maintenance of French Door Windows
Keeping French door windows is necessary to guarantee their longevity and optimal efficiency. Here are some upkeep tips:
- Regular Cleaning: Clean the glass and frames routinely using moderate soap and water to eliminate dirt, grime, and finger prints.
- Examine Seals: Inspect seals and weather-stripping regularly to prevent leakages and drafts.
- Paint or Stain: If made from wood, routinely repaint or stain the surface areas to secure versus weathering.
- Hardware Inspection: Ensure hinges, deals with, and locking mechanisms are in great working condition and lubricate them when needed.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Are French doors energy efficient?
Yes, many contemporary French doors come with energy-efficient features like double or triple glazing, which helps to minimize heat loss and UV exposure.
2. How much do French door windows cost?
The expense can differ commonly depending on design, material, and setup complexities. Standard models may begin around ₤ 500 per door, while custom-built or high-end options can surpass ₤ 2,000.
3. Can French doors be set up in existing walls?
Yes, French doors can be installed in existing walls, however it frequently requires structural modifications. Working with a professional contractor is advised for such jobs.
4. Are French doors secure?
While some people may assume French doors are less protected, manufacturers offer enhanced glass and lock systems that can improve security.
5. Can French doors be utilized inside?
Absolutely! French doors can function as elegant room dividers, adding character and supplying sight lines between areas while keeping a limit.
